Complete 2012 NFL Draft Round 5 Results

The 2012 NFL Draft rolls on, and the amount of impact players has begun to dwindle. At this stage, teams look for developmental players and depth guys to fill out the roster. But a handful of potential starters have slipped into the fifth round of this draft.

Two of the best picks in this round came right off the bat. The Indianapolis Colts took Alabama defensive tackle Josh Chapman, who will be an outstanding space eater in the middle of Indy's defensive line. His knee issues caused him to fall a bit. The Colts also managed to grab an impressive running back in Vick Ballard with the last pick of Round 5.

With the very next pick in the fifth round, the Denver Broncos took Tennessee defense lineman Malik Jackson. An incredibly versatile player, Jackson has the ability to contribute to Denver's defensive line down the road.

A few big time sleepers came off the board as well. The Carolina Panthers scooped up Coastal Carolina's Josh Norman and the Atlanta Falcons grabbed Troy defensive end Jonathan Massaquoi. Both of those players could start in the NFL within the next couple of years.

But the best pick of the round belongs to the Cincinnati Bengals, who stole California's Marvin Jones in the fifth round. This has been said a lot over the last couple of days, but the Bengals really are drafting well. Jones will end up being one of the best receivers in this draft.

136. Indianapolis Colts - Josh Chapman - Defensive Tackle - Alabama
137. Denver Broncos - Malik Jackson - Defensive End - Tennessee
138. Detroit Lions - Tahir Whitehead - Outside Linebacker - Temple
139. Minnesota Vikings - Robert Blanton - Cornerback - Notre Dame
140. Tampa Bay Buccaneers - Najee Goode - Linebacker - West Virginia
141. Washington Redskins - Adam Gettis - Guard - Iowa
142. Jacksonville Jaguars - Brandon Marshall - Linebacker - Nevada
143. Carolina Panthers - Josh Norman - Cornerback - Coastal Carolina
144. Buffalo Bills - Zebrie Sanders - Offensive Tackle - Florida State
145. Tennessee Titans - Taylor Thompson - Tight End - SMU
146. Kansas City Chiefs - De'Quan Menzie - Cornerback - Alabama
147. Buffalo Bills - Tank Carder - Linebacker - TCU
148. Detroit Lions - Chris Greenwood - Cornerback - Albion
149. San Diego Chargers - Johnnie Troutman - Guard - Penn State
150. St. Louis Rams - Rokevious Watkins - Offensive Tackle - South Carolina
151. Arizona Cardinals - Senio Kelemete - Offensive Tackle Washington
152. Dallas Cowboys - Danny Coale - Wide Receiver - Virginia Tech
153. Philadelphia Eagles - Dennis Kelly - Offensive Tackle - Purdue
154. Seattle Seahawks - Korey Toomer - Linebacker - Idaho
155. Miami Dolphins - Josh Kaddu - Linebacker - Oregon
156. Cincinnati Bengals - Shaun Prater - Cornerback - Iowa
157. Atlanta Falcons - Bradie Ewing - Fullback - Wisconsin
158. Oakland Raiders - Jack Crawford - Defensive End - Penn State
159. Pittsburgh Steelers - Chris Rainey - Running Back - Florida
160. Cleveland Browns - Ryan Miller - Guard - Colorado
161. Houston Texans - Randol Bullock - Kicker - Texas A&M
162. New Orleans Saints - Corey White - Safety - Samford
163. Green Bay Packers - Terrell Manning - Linebacker - N.C. State
164. Atlanta Falcons - Jonathan Massaquoi - Defensive End - Troy
165. San Francisco 49ers - Darius Fleming - Linebacker - Notre Dame
166. Cincinnati Bengals - Marvin Jones - Wide Receiver - California
167. Cincinnati Bengals - George Iloka - Safety - Boise State
168. Oakland Raiders - Juron Criner - Wide Receiver - Arizona
169. Baltimore Ravens - Asa Jackson - Cornerback - Cal. Poly
170. Indianapolis Colts - Vick Ballard - Running Back - Mississippi State
